Youthnet Art Show Benefit   Deadline: April 30th.
Youthnet is pleased to announce an evening of art, wine and jazz to on May 30th at our building in Mount Vernon (227 N 4th Street, top of the viaduct) and a month long preview sale/art walk at downtown Mount Vernon businesses. Youthnet’s programs include Foster Care, Independent Living Skills, Parent Support Program, and Emerson High School.  On average, six hundred children and their families benefit from Youthnet's services each year.

At the art show sale benefit event we would like to share equally (50/50) with you the proceeds from the sale of any artwork you submit (outright donations will be accepted too).

In cooperation with downtown Mount Vernon Businesses we will display works of art (number depends on location) for sale in local businesses for the month prior to the event to publicize the benefit and we would like to share equally (50/50) with you the proceeds from the sales of your artwork.

Display locations: SV Food Coop, Lincoln Theatre, The Porterhouse Pub, The Trumpeter Restaurant, River and Main Gifts, Skagit Business Services, Paccioni’s, Tri-dees, MV Bike Shop,, The Libation Station Wine Shop

Artists participating (so far): Joel Brock, Debbie Aldrich, Jeanne Hansen, Jane Lloyd, Jacques Moitoriet, Suzy Carr, Janet Foster, Jaqueline deGavia, …….

The art show/auction will feature the Oscar de la Rosa Trio, catering by Mark’s on Pine Square and Carpenter Creek wines!

Call for Public Art – Swift Bus Stations, Lynnwood, WA

Budget - $38,000  -  Deadline: June 30, 2008

The City of Lynnwood Arts Commission invites Washington State artists to apply for this project to create art for six bus stations. The budget of $38,000 includes design, fabrication and installation.

The swift bus is a program of Community Transit (CT) in Snohomish County. It will travel on Highway 99 between Everett and Shoreline. Swift bus will start running by the end of 2009. Six swift bus stations will be located in the City of Lynnwood.  Part of the ground area of each station will include art.
